It was during a normal fight that it happened. Sam was waiting nearby, looking for ways she could help. Tucker was hacking into something, and Danny had just blasted the ghost with an eco-plasmic ray. Then it occurred to him: What other girl could compare to Sam?

His mind began going over a 'girl check list' he hadn't even been aware he had.

Does she make reference to my existence on the face of the earth? (Yep, that's how soon Paulina was out) Well, yeah. Duh. Sam's my best friend.

Does she accept everything about me, (within reason)? (There went Valerie…) Wow, yeah. Seriously Fenton, what other girl seems willing to accept someone who is technically half dead, and technically a freak? And a nerd at school?

Is she good looking?

Danny dodged a quick attack from the weakening ghost to peak over at Sam, who had found her own ghost to fight.

Definitely check.

Is she fun to be around? Danny's shy mind flashed back to a couple certain "fake-out make-outs" and then he shook his head, thinking of all the fun he had had with her and Tuck instead.

How did I never notice how darn pretty that girl is? Danny thought, catching the Fenton Thermos Tucker tossed him and sucked the ghost in. His fairly sharp mind directed his attention to Sam's ghost, and he felt his adrenalin kick in. "Tucker!" He called, motioning for his friend to follow him.

Bonus items: He thought, as the three quickly began to defeat the ghost. Strongly independent. Smart. Pretty. Capable of holding her own in a fight – wow. Sam was almost leading this fight with her Spector Deflector and various other gadgets. Pretty. Did I mention that already?

The ghosts now all in the thermos, Danny floated to his friends. They all high fived good naturedly, as Danny worked up some nerve.

"Sam?" He asked, waiting until violet met blue. Danny placed his hands on her shoulders gently, as he was still floating without legs and only a ghostly tail, and quite a bit off the ground.

"Hmm?" She replied, her eyes still dancing from the fight's excitement but now concealing a tiny bit of confusion.

"I need you." Danny said suddenly, feeling abrupt and out of sorts. "I mean – oh crud – I like you, Sam. I've never said anything before this about us, but now all I want to do is kiss you." The words began running together faster as he spoke.

"Kiss me?" Sam restated the question, unsure. "I – " As she spoke however, her lips were caught up in Danny's.

(You can bet Tucker was smirking. Took 'em long enough!)

They parted. Danny could never have imagined how soft herlips would be. For a moment they just stayed in place, Danny flosting up unconsciously, his arm around her shoulders and his other holding her hand. Sam buried her head in his jumpsuited chest.

She looked up happily, contentedly, at him. "I like you a lot, mister. You know that?"

Danny's grin widened. "I like you a lot too, Sam. His hand felt the back of her neck and tilted her head back. Slowly, tenderly, they kissed again.

Just then they heard the Spector Speeder horn beep. Together they looked up to Tucker. He called through the speaker system;

"Hey lovebirds, you guys ready to head home?"
